spine_preprocess: Preprocess data for spine chart

Description Usage Arguments Details Value

View source: R/spine_chart_utils.R

Description

Returns a data frame with the latest time period of data for each indicator name.

Usage

1
spine_preprocess(data, indicator, timeperiod_sortable)

Arguments

data

a data frame to create the spine chart from. the data frame should contain data for all area types included in the chart (eg, if plotting for County & UA with a comparator of region and a median line for national, the data frame should contain all of these data)

indicator

unquoted field name for indicators. This should be what is presented as the label for the final spine chart, hence should be unique for each vertabra. Be careful the indicator doesn't have sub-categories based on other fields, such as sex (male, female, persons) or age group

timeperiod_sortable

unquoted field name containing the time period that is numeric and sortable, such that higher values are a later time period

Details

This processing only takes place on the indicator field and the time period field provided. If the data contains multiple sexes or age groups for an indicator, make sure the indicator field reflects this.

Value

A processed data frame for latest time periods of given indicators
